PTU Tutorial

Feeling Lucky !




Supplies needed:

Paint Shop Pro X or any version

Tamara SV (1)(included in kit)

RD_mask 739 here

AWS_Luck To You here here here, coming soon here

Rockybilly font here

DD_Feeling Lucky Template (I could not find a link to this template)

 

Disclaimer: This tutorial is written by Pamela Mabry on March 14, 2024  and is solely from my own imagination, any resemblance to any other/s is pure coincidence. This tutorial is written for those with a working knowledge of Paint Shop Pro.

Remember: to apply your drop shadow as you proceed. I used h and v 2, opacity 30, blur 10.

Let’s begin

Open template, shift + d

Image, canvas size 800 x 800, center

Delete credit, raster 14, right dark green square, right gold rectangle and stitches layers

Close all word art and clover layers

Highlight background layer, fill white

Apply a new layer, select all

Paste paper 21 into selection

Apply mask, merge group

Click on the left gold rectangle layer,

 right click, merge, merge down

Select all, float, defloat

C/p paper 12 into selection

Click the left light gold square, merge down

Select all, float, defloat

C/p paper 7 into selection

Select all, float, defloat the dark green slats

C/p paper 18 into selection

Select all, float, defloat the green oval

C/p paper 16 into selection, keep selected

C/p Tamara SV (4) as a new layer

Resize 60%, duplicate, highlight raster 1

Adjust, blur, motion blur




Click on copy of tube, change blend mode to hard light

Apply ds to tube

Select, float, defloat the dark green square

C/p paper 14 into selection

C/p Tamara SV 3 as new layer

Resize 50%, move into square 

Selections, invert, delete, select none

Duplicate tube, on original apply a radial blur 



Change opacity to 50
Go to tube copy and change blend to soft light
Apply drop shadow
Go to rectangle, select all, float, defloat
C/p Tamara SV tube 3, rs 50%
Line this up under the previous tube
Duplicate tube, apply above blur to original
Reduce opacity to 50
On tube copy apply soft light and drop shadow
C/p element 23 under the slats
C/p el 97, rs 80%, move to top left
Duplicate, flip, mirror
C/p el 30 above the slats, rs 70%, image, free rotate right at 15
El 33 - 60%
El 42 - 40%
El 40 - 30%
El 72 - 30%, move bottom right, duplicate, mirror
Duplicate, move slightly down, duplicate, mirror
El 11 - 40%
El 96 - 60%
El 14 - 60%
Merge down all word art layers and the clover
Resize 60%, move to top or where you desire
C/p Tamara SV 1, resize 60%
You're done.

FTU Tutorial
Irish Garden

Supplies needed:

Paint Shop Pro 2023 or any version

Tube: Magic Lantern by Fiodorova Maria here

Mask: WSL mask 221 here

Scrap: Miz_Irish Luck here

Font: Livingstone here

Template: 0012 by me: here

 

Disclaimer: This tutorial is written by Pamela Mabry on March 8, 2023 and is solely from my own imagination, any similarity to any other/s is pure coincidence. This tutorial is written with the assumption that you have a working knowledge of Paint Shop Pro.

Remember to apply your drop shadow as you proceed.  I used h and v 2 opacity 30 blur 10

Let’s begin!

 Open the template, delete the credit, frame border, body and glass lens layers

Highlight the background layer ,add a new layer

Select all, paste paper 8 into selection

Apply mask, merge group

Click the strips layer, select all, float, defloat

Choose the rectangle, select all, float, defloat

Paste paper 14 into selection, keep selected

Copy your close-up and paste as new layer, resize 70%, position. invert, delete

Change blend to multiply. select none, apply ds to tube and rectangle

 Merge tube layer down, apply ds again

Click on dodge back 1 and click with your magic wand, hold down your shift key

While holding shift key click dodge back 2 layer and click with magic wand

While holding shift key click dodge back 3 layer and click with magic wand

Now, all 3  should have marching ants around them

 Add new layer

Paper 9, paste into selection

Copy full tube, paste as new layer, resize 70%, position, invert, delete

Change blend mode to multiply, apply ds, select none

Merge down to cover all dodge backs, apply ds

element io, 70%, image, free rotate, right, 30, ok

element 7

element 24, 80%

element 22

element 3

element 69

element 68

element 1 - 80%

element 2 - 70%

element 20 - 60%,  duplicate and move slightly down to the right

element 10 - 60%

element 30 - 40%

element 91 - 20%

Add your tube, copyright info and name.

You're done!
